Here's what RT said in the article:
"Bosco is kind of in love with Lisbon," Tunney says. "That brings up Patrick's feelings about me, which is like a little bit of a triangle, and it's fun. It's nice to be fought over, but it's very subtle. There's a lot of looks, and Patrick is a little jealous, just as Bosco is jealous of the attention that Patrick gets from Lisbon. The closeness that we have is infuriating to him."
